## Runbook: Orchid API N+1 Fix

The resolver batching layer (Loomfetch) eliminates the N+1 on nested `crewMembers` queries. Keep batch size at 50; higher values trip the Parloch gateway limits. Loomfetch authenticates to the read replica pool independently of the main API. Before restarting the service, ensure the env file contains the replica credential on the line below:

secret setting of hawep-yahig: LEDGER_TOKEN29=41b5d6315371c92885eaeb077fb63

## Artifact Signing — StockPilot

Every StockPilot release artifact (planner binary, route optimizer, and machine-inventory schemas) must be signed before it reaches the distribution bucket. The restock scheduler on customer sites refuses unsigned updates, so a missed signature blocks all fleets. Sign after the checksum step, never before. The release manager performs signing with the key below.

deploy key for kajof-fajop: bky6_gDHw9Q

## Configuration

The user module now runs as `userd`, split from the Brackenfell monolith. On-call: if auth fails after deploy, check that `userd` and the monolith share the same signing secret, or sessions will invalidate mid-flight. Copy `.env.example` to `.env`, set `USERD_PORT=7012`, and point `MONOLITH_URL` at the internal gateway. Then add the shared session signing secret on the next line:

secret setting of yajog-taguf: ARCHIVE_KEY3=051